Mr BAILEY - 1995-06-20

The last audit of Modular Medical Products, a government company or at least a company which has significant government investment in it, was carried out in 1991. As a result of that audit, the 1991 annual return filed with the Australian Securities Commission revealed deficiencies. As we pointed out previously, the company has sustained operating losses totalling more than $500 000 since that time, yet no further audits have been carried out. Has the Chief Minister been advised of this adverse audit report? What action did he take to clear up the deficiencies referred to in the audit report, and to ensure that taxpayers' funds have been protected since 1991?

ANSWER

Mr Speaker, I believe the Leader of the Opposition raised this matter with me at the last sittings. I spoke immediately with the Secretary of the Department of Industries and Development, and gave instructions on all the matters that the member for Wanguri has put to me this morning.
